Transaction 9403f4913edd79b90df4f9e0945c1bd47d2b876407b49a1871270853d23945af

1 Input
2 Outputs
  • 9403f4913edd79b90df4f9e0945c1bd47d2b876407b49a1871270853d23945af:0
  • value  38781000
    address  17pozye5XSanvMpH4KXUL6UzoqDitHwPC6
  • 9403f4913edd79b90df4f9e0945c1bd47d2b876407b49a1871270853d23945af:1
  • value  20618600400
    address  3HXtKSiZZsCwUH1KaKGb7T2wvPTpCMwp33